在当今数据爆炸的时代,如何从海量私有数据中快速准确地找到所需信息成为了企业和开发者面临的重要挑战。DeepSearcher作为开源深度研究工具,通过其创新的智能路由机制和多集合检索策略,为私有数据推理提供了完整的解决方案。
🔍 什么是DeepSearcher智能路由?
DeepSearcher的智能路由机制是其核心功能之一,它能够自动将用户查询分发到最相关的数据集合中进行检索。这种机制基于先进的语义理解技术,确保每个查询都能在最合适的数据源中获得最佳答案。
🚀 多集合数据检索的工作原理
DeepSearcher的多集合检索策略通过以下步骤实现智能搜索:
- 查询解析与子查询生成:用户输入的自然语言查询首先被大语言模型解析,生成多个相关的子查询
- 集合路由决策:智能路由器根据子查询的语义内容,决定将其发送到哪个数据集合
- 并行向量检索:在选定的集合中同时进行语义搜索
- 结果融合与优化:将各集合的检索结果进行智能融合和总结
📊 性能优势与评估结果
DeepSearcher的智能路由机制在检索性能方面表现出色:
从评估结果可以看出,随着迭代次数的增加,DeepSearcher的召回率显著提升。特别是当使用Claude-3-7-Sonnet等先进模型时,Recall@5指标接近完美的1.0,远高于传统的Naive RAG方法。
💡 实际应用场景
DeepSearcher的智能路由和多集合检索策略在以下场景中表现卓越:
企业知识管理
- 内部文档、技术手册、政策文件的多源检索
- 跨部门知识共享与查询
学术研究支持
- 文献资料的高效搜索
- 多数据库联合查询
技术文档检索
- API文档、开发指南的智能搜索
- 代码库与文档的关联查询
🛠️ 快速上手配置
配置DeepSearcher的智能路由机制非常简单:
- 数据准备:将不同来源的数据组织成逻辑集合
- 路由规则定义:根据业务需求设置路由策略
- 检索参数优化:调整迭代次数和模型选择以获得最佳性能
🔧 核心技术组件
DeepSearcher的智能路由机制依赖于以下关键组件:
- 大语言模型(LLM):负责查询理解和子查询生成
- 向量数据库(Milvus):提供高效的语义搜索能力
- 反射决策引擎:动态评估知识缺口并优化检索策略
🎯 最佳实践建议
为了充分发挥DeepSearcher智能路由机制的优势,建议:
- 合理划分数据集合:根据数据类型和使用频率进行分组
- 优化路由规则:基于实际查询模式调整路由策略
- 定期评估性能:监控检索效果并持续优化配置
📈 未来发展方向
DeepSearcher项目持续演进,智能路由机制也在不断优化。未来将支持更复杂的路由策略、更多的数据源类型以及更智能的结果融合算法。
✨ 总结
DeepSearcher的智能路由机制和多集合数据检索策略为私有数据的高效搜索提供了革命性的解决方案。通过自动化的查询分发和智能的结果融合,用户可以快速获得准确、全面的信息,显著提升了数据利用效率和工作生产力。
无论你是企业用户、开发者还是研究人员,DeepSearcher都能为你提供强大的数据检索能力,帮助你在海量信息中找到真正有价值的内容。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考





